It's not uncommon to find yourself in a relationship where the feelings of love and stability coexist uneasily. You might realize that you've chosen your current partner for their good behavior and stability, yet you experience a strong attraction towards someone else, feeling a depth of emotion that you're missing in your current partnership. This article aims to provide guidance on how to navigate these complex feelings and make the best decision for your emotional well-being.

Understanding Your Feelings

Reflect on Your Feelings: Take time to understand the different emotions you're experiencing. What drives your attraction towards your crush? Is it excitement, passion, or a deeper emotional connection that you're missing in your current relationship? Recognizing these feelings can help you make clearer decisions and assess whether they should influence your choice.

Evaluating Your Relationship

Assess Your Relationship: Revisit the reasons why you selected your current partner. Stability and kindness are essential, but they may not be enough for a fulfilling long-term relationship. Is your relationship stagnant, and are there areas that need improvement? Analyze whether your current partnership has the potential to evolve and grow.

Open Communication

Communicate: If you feel comfortable, discuss your feelings with your partner. Open and honest communication can sometimes foster a deeper emotional connection that could be lacking. However, be mindful of your approach to avoid unnecessary hurt. Consider the possibility that your crush feelings might also reflect areas where you can improve your relationship.

Expanding Your Perspective

Explore Your Crush: Before making any decision, take the time to understand the reasons behind your crush feelings. This doesn't mean you have to act on them, but understanding the underlying triggers can provide clarity. This exploration can help you identify what you truly want in a relationship and whether it aligns with reality.

Consider the Consequences

Consider the Consequences: Think about the potential outcomes of pursuing your crush. Could it lead to a happier relationship, or could it cause pain and complications for you and your partner? Consider how each path might affect your livelihood and emotional well-being.

Seeking Outside Perspective

Talking to a trusted friend or a therapist can provide an outside perspective and help you sort through your emotions. These external views can offer valuable insights that you might not have considered previously. Seeking guidance can also help you make more informed decisions and navigate challenges more effectively.

Conclusion

The ultimate decision should be based on what you believe will lead to your happiness and fulfillment in the long run. Being honest with yourself and your partner is crucial in this process. Choose a path that aligns with your values and ensures a sustainable and satisfying relationship.
